The Twin Arc Coating Process

Different from the Precision oilfield grinding services Houston that Fusion has, comes the Twin Arc coating process. This process will use two metallic wires that have an electrical charge with opposing polarity and are fed into the arc gun. When the wires are brought together at the contact point, the opposing charges on the wires create enough heat to continuously melt the tips of the wires. As a result, the coating will project onto the substrate.

The features of the twin arc process differ from the Precision oilfield grinding services Houston slightly. The twin arc systems are compact and will not experience component distortion. This system will produce high spray rates and the coating of some internal bores is possible. The Plasma Spray Process

Different from Precision oilfield grinding services Houston is the Plasma Spray process. This is a high-frequency arc that is lit between a nozzle and an electrode. Gases will flow between them and become a plume of hot plasma gas reaching from 12,000 degrees Fahrenheit to 30,000-degree Fahrenheit. The coating material will melt and propel towards the substrate that then forms the coating. Fusion Inc. can accurately regulate coating results which is to the advantage of the client. There is a respectable distance between the plasma gun and substrate. This distance allows Fusion Inc. to be in control of the spray temperature which is usually between 100- and 500-degrees Fahrenheit.
